I've seen firsthand how effective PR can transform a brand's reputation and market presence. HOST: That's impressive! Now, what current trends or challenges are shaping the Food PR landscape today? GUEST: There's a growing demand for authenticity and transparency. Consumers want to know the story behind their food, and they're more skeptical of traditional marketing methods. Brands need to find new, creative ways to build trust and connect with their audience. HOST: That's a great point. Now, what would you say are some common challenges students face when learning Food PR, or instructors when teaching it? GUEST: One challenge is translating theoretical knowledge into practical application. Students often struggle with adapting PR strategies to real-world scenarios. As an instructor, it's crucial to provide hands-on, experiential learning opportunities. HOST: Indeed, practical experience is invaluable. Lastly, how do you see the future of Food PR evolving, especially in light of digital advancements and changing consumer behaviors? GUEST: The future of Food PR is digital and data-driven. Brands will need to leverage AI, social media, and data analytics to understand their audience and deliver personalized, engaging content.
